F3: Fun and Frustration (2022) [N/A]

Release Date:
May 27, 2022

Original Title:
F3: ఫన్ అండ్ ఫ్రస్టేషన్

Alternate Titles:
F3 - Fun and Frustration
F3: FF2
Fun and Frustration 2
抛妻奇谈2

Genres:
Comedy | Romance

Production Companies:
Sri Venkateswara Creations

Production Countries:
India

Ratings / Certifications:
IE: 12  IN: UA  RO: 15 

Runtime: 148

Venky and Varun Yadav are ordinary guys with ordinary lives. Their struggle is all about money. One day they hear about a wealthy industrialist in Vijayanagaram who is looking for his heir. What happens when Venky, Varun and the gang arrive at his doorsteps pretending to be his heir.
